    Hi Dentalnurse,

    I assure you there is nothing to worry about re: the report writing. I did mine in Febreuary and did not finish all of it (as far as I remember I finished four or five pages and left 2-3 pages untouched). A week later got a letter informing that I passed. I think what they care about more is the quality rather than quantity (within reason). If you paid attention to details both written and graphic and produced an accurate description of 70% of the scenario you will be fine (according to my experience).

    Firstly, best of luck tomorrow sdonn :). The interview panel will be fair & you will feel relaxed from the get go. Try and come with various scenarios for the sections you know they will touch on but also a scenario or two on conflict resolution. Confidence & Honesty should shine through. It is formal so a suit would be advisable alright.

    You don't have to finish the report but they will be checking for spelling & grammar mostly on the amount that you do write. That section is okay being honest but I would advise keeping an 'odd' eye on the time though.
